April 7, 2005 April’s Ambrosian of the month is Ryan Dye, assistant professor and chair of the history and geography department. He also chairs the Faculty Assembly, and is a member of the board of advisors for the Catholic studies lecture. “I’m very grateful to be recognized by the
university for my work,” said Dye. He has helped build the Irish studies program by getting students interested in Irish culture. He also works with the St. Patrick Society. “An award like this inspires you to want to do more and to want to continue to work hard,” said Dye. Being the advisor for the honor society Phi Eta Sigma, he was influential in the adoption of a Rwandan family. Students and Dye worked with the World Relief Organization in helping the family furnish their apartment. They also visit the family to help them adjust to American life. “This award says a lot about St. Ambrose, that it gives faculty the opportunity to pursue many different interests and encourages us to do that,” said Dye. “And I think that’s pretty unique.” |
